What can I see and do near Kuromontei?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at National Museum of Western Art, Meiji University Museum, or Tokyo Metropolitan Art Museum. Sights like Sensoji Temple, Tokyo Imperial Palace, and Yushima Tenman-gu Shrine are landmarks to visit in the area. You can check out the local talent at Tokyo Bunka Kaikan, Nihonbashi Mitsui Hall, and Asakusa Public Hall.
How can I get to Kuromontei?
With so many choices for transportation, seeing the area around Kuromontei is easy. Local metro stations include Ueno-okachimachi Station and Ueno-hirokoji Station. If you're hopping a train into town, Ueno Station, Keisei-Ueno Station, and Okachimachi Station are the closest stations to Ueno.
